Removing A-pillar trim









1. Using a screwdriver, unclip the cap -7- from the A-pillar trim.





2. Unscrew fastening screw -6-.





3. Starting at the fastening bolt -5- at the top, unclip A-pillar trim from the clip connections.





4. Unclip A-pillar trim -1- in an upward direction.






Installing A-pillar trim

Installing A-pillar trim panel





1. Check fastening clips -8- for deformation; replace if necessary.





2. Insert retaining catches -3- on the A-pillar trim -1- into the fastening clips -2- and the instrument panel guide slot.









3. Insert the retaining catch -4- into A-pillar side trim at the bottom.





4. Clip A-pillar trim -1- into A-pillar from bottom to top. Make sure that the fastening bolt reaches into the fastening bore.





5. Screw in fastening screw -6- and tighten to the specified tightening torque. => Tightening torque: 3 ftlb.+0.25 ftlb.





6. Clip cap -7- into A-pillar trim recess.
